Prevalence of hepatitis B among Afghan refugees living in Balochistan, Pakistan.

Explore this paper's citation graph

Summary

Hepatitis B is highly endemic among Afghan refugees living in these camps and the possibility of mother-to-child transmission underscores the need to include vaccination against hepatitis B as part of routine immunization in this population.
